数据库场景编程是什么工作
-
数据库场景编程是一种将数据库技术与编程技术相结合的工作。它涉及到使用编程语言来设计、开发和管理数据库系统,以满足特定的业务需求和应用场景。
在数据库场景编程中,首先需要了解和掌握数据库的基本概念和原理,例如关系型数据库、非关系型数据库、数据模型、表、字段、索引等。这些知识对于理解和操作数据库非常重要。
其次,数据库场景编程需要熟悉至少一种数据库编程语言,例如SQL、PL/SQL、T-SQL等。通过这些编程语言,可以对数据库进行创建、查询、更新和删除等操作,以实现对数据的管理和处理。
数据库场景编程还需要具备一定的算法和数据结构知识,以优化数据库的性能和效率。例如,使用合适的索引、优化查询语句、避免冗余数据等。
此外,数据库场景编程还需要与其他技术和工具进行集成,例如Web开发、移动应用开发、云计算等。通过与这些技术的结合,可以实现更复杂和丰富的数据库应用。
总之,数据库场景编程是一项综合性的工作,需要掌握数据库基础知识、编程语言、算法和数据结构等技能。通过合理的设计和开发,可以实现高效、安全和可靠的数据库应用。
1年前 -
数据库场景编程是指根据具体的业务需求,使用编程语言对数据库进行操作和管理的工作。它主要包括以下几个方面的工作:
-
数据库设计和建模:数据库场景编程的第一步是根据业务需求设计数据库模型。这包括确定实体、属性和关系,并绘制实体关系图。设计良好的数据库模型能够提高数据的存储效率和查询性能。
-
数据库连接与操作:在数据库场景编程中,需要使用编程语言与数据库进行连接,并执行各种数据库操作,如插入、更新、删除和查询等。通过编程语言提供的API或者ORM(对象关系映射)工具,可以方便地操作数据库。
-
数据库性能优化:在数据库场景编程中,需要关注数据库的性能问题。可以通过优化数据库的索引、查询语句的编写和数据库服务器的参数设置等方式来提高数据库的性能。此外,还可以使用缓存、分库分表等技术来优化数据库的性能。
-
数据库安全性管理:数据库场景编程需要关注数据库的安全性。这包括对敏感数据进行加密、设置访问权限、防止SQL注入攻击等。同时,还需要定期备份数据库,并建立灾备机制,以确保数据的安全和可靠性。
-
数据库监控与调优:数据库场景编程需要监控数据库的运行状态,及时发现和解决数据库的问题。可以使用数据库性能监控工具来收集数据库的性能指标,并根据指标进行调优。此外,还可以使用数据库的分析工具来分析数据库的查询性能,找出慢查询并进行优化。
总之,数据库场景编程是一项涉及数据库设计、连接、操作、性能优化、安全管理和监控调优等工作的综合性任务。通过合理的数据库场景编程,可以提高数据库的性能、安全性和可靠性,从而更好地支持业务需求。
1年前 -
-
数据库场景编程是指根据特定的业务场景需求,利用编程语言和数据库技术,开发和实现与数据库交互的应用程序。数据库场景编程是数据库开发的一部分,它主要涉及以下几个方面的工作:
-
数据库设计:在数据库场景编程的开始阶段,需要进行数据库的设计。这包括确定数据库的结构、表和字段的定义、索引的创建等。数据库设计的目标是满足业务需求,提高数据的存储和检索效率。
-
数据库连接:在数据库场景编程中,需要建立与数据库的连接,以便应用程序能够与数据库进行交互。通常使用数据库连接池来管理数据库连接,以提高性能和可靠性。
-
SQL编程:在数据库场景编程中,使用结构化查询语言(SQL)进行数据库操作。SQL语句可以用于查询、插入、更新和删除数据,以及创建和修改表结构等。编写高效和安全的SQL语句是数据库场景编程的重要一环。
-
事务管理:在数据库场景编程中,事务管理是非常重要的。事务是一组数据库操作的逻辑单元,要么全部执行成功,要么全部回滚。通过使用事务,可以确保数据库的一致性和完整性。
-
数据库访问层开发:在数据库场景编程中,通常会开发一个数据库访问层,用于封装数据库操作的细节。这样可以提高代码的可维护性和重用性,降低与数据库交互的复杂度。
-
数据库优化:在数据库场景编程中,需要对数据库进行性能优化。这包括优化查询语句、创建合适的索引、调整数据库参数等。通过优化数据库,可以提高系统的响应速度和并发能力。
-
数据库安全性管理:在数据库场景编程中,需要考虑数据库的安全性。这包括对数据进行加密、用户权限管理、防止SQL注入攻击等。保护数据库的安全可以防止数据泄露和损坏。
总之,数据库场景编程是一项复杂的工作,需要结合数据库技术和编程语言的知识,根据业务需求进行数据库设计和开发,以实现高效、安全和可靠的数据库应用程序。
1年前 -